On a question of Erdős and Nešetřil about minimal cuts in a graph
Abstract
Answering a question of Erdős and Nešetřil, we show that the maximum number of inclusion-wise minimal vertex cuts in a graph on n vertices is at most 1.8899n for large enough n.
